The author describes the following case: a patient 2 years ago had allegedly suffered from typhoid fever and since then has been experiencing pains in the right thigh, which doctors sometimes take for rheumatic or neuralgic; there are no outward signs of disease in the thigh, only a strong pain on pressing in the middle part of the thigh from the outside.
